What you will do
This student role will support a few teams in HR that manage various policies and programs including Learning & Development, Employee Relations and Health and Safety.
Specifically you will:
- Support various programs in the Leadership and Employee Development team, including administration and coordination of virtual and digital learning programs and administration of the learning management system.
- Support the curation and administration of learning content in a new learning platform.
- Support the maintenance of the learning matrix
- Support various Health & Safety processes (including reporting and coordination of committee meetings in accordance with the Canada Labour Code)
- Keep ergonomics data up to date (in the context of our hybrid work model)
- Coordinate the first aid program
- Support all administrative functions of the employee relations team

Remote work / Hybrid Work Model #LI-Remote
The Bank is conducting a trial of a hybrid working model which provides employees with the flexibility to telework for significant portions of each month. During the trial, employees will only be required to come onsite on those days when they are involved in activities that they or their leader feel are better conducted in person. For the majority of employees, it is expected that onsite time will range from 5 to 10 days per month, depending on your role. You are expected to live in Canada, and within reasonable commuting distance of the office. For this position, should you not live within reasonable commuting distance of the office, you will be able to work 100% remote (within Canada) for the duration of this term.
